Learn more about Online Agricultural Economics MBA degree programs
Studying Agricultural Economics through an MBA online allows you to engage deeply with the intersection of agriculture, economics, and business management. This field is particularly relevant as global demands for food production and sustainability increase.
As you explore this discipline, you'll focus on courses like agricultural policy analysis, farm management strategies, and sustainable resource management. These subjects help you develop skills such as conducting economic forecasts, analyzing market trends, and crafting strategies for agricultural businesses. Many learners find valuable tools in data analysis and financial modeling as they work on enhancing farm efficiency and profitability.
The environment encourages independence and curiosity while equipping you with skills that are applicable in diverse sectors, including government agencies and private firms. Graduates often pursue roles in agricultural consulting, supply chain management, or policy advisement, where they can impact global food systems and sustainability efforts.
